The Panthers placed Nate Salley on season-ending injured reserve on Wednesday, according to the Charlotte Observer. He has been sidelined by a knee injury since mid-training camp. Salley had been penciled in as a starter before he suffered the injury. This is a tough break for the Panthers, as safety is clearly an area of weakness for their defense.
